

ThandiBra
Based on recent customer reviews, ThandiBra is facing significant customer dissatisfaction centred on claims of misleading advertising. Customers consistently mention that products marketed as locally designed and manufactured in Cape Town appear to arrive from China, often in original Shein or Temu packaging. A recurring theme is frustration with lengthy delivery times stretching into weeks, perceived poor product quality relative to price, incorrect sizing, and refund policies that customers feel contradict the South African Consumer Protection Act. Many shoppers also report receiving what they believe are AI generated email responses to their complaints.

On their website this shop claims that their bras were designed for South African women, and are made here. Their prices are pretty high, but with their promises of a top-quality product, one expects the best. On ordering from them, I discovered that the goods come from China, not locally made at all. The delivery time was around a month, whereas one would expect a product locally shipped to arrive within a few days. This business does definitely not get a good review from me.

I ordered an XL bra on-line for over R600.00. On delivery only to find the bag was marked XL but the bra itself was a SMAL size. Numerous email communications between Thandi and I, she acknowledged the mistake and said she would replace the bra on condition that I pay, once again, for shipping of R172.00. I have advised her that she clearly needs the bra more than I and to keep it.
